    For the longest time, I always thought that Oakobing was the go-to place when it comes to finding good Bingsu (Korean shaved ice dessert) in KTown, but there certainly was a paradigm shift after trying this place out! Ooyoo is a solid contender for the spot of best bingsu purveyor in KTown, the place is a bit difficult to find but well worth it once you manage to get to it. The seating itself is such a nice touch. There are big booth-like, semi round couches outside with what looks like a fireplace in the middle, so perfect for large groups. My favorite was the strawberry bingsu, but the other two flavors that we tried were very (injeolmi and black sesame) were also highly recommended. They also sell Ah-Boong, a fish-shaped waffle cone filled with your choice of filling. We went with the red bean paste, and it was great. Parking isn't too difficult in the area either.
